VOLUNTEERS NEEDED FOR STRAWBERRY FESTIVAL AND BOOK FAIR

 

April showers bring May flowers and those May flowers mean strawberry season is not far behind.  Even before the rains of April arrive, the Friends of the Library of Windham (F.L.O.W.) are actively planning this June’s Strawberry Festival and Book Fair. 

This year, the Festival is scheduled for Saturday, June 2nd at Windham High School. 

This annual community event would not be possible without the time and talents of the people of Windham. 

F.L.O.W. needs volunteers to help on numerous fronts including baking biscuits, cutting strawberries, painting kids’ faces, helping with the Book Fair, and the list goes on and on. 

Each year hundreds of individuals from our community make the Strawberry Festival possible for the thousands that attend the event.  Volunteers can help in advance of the Festival or on the day of the Festival. 

No contribution of your time or talent is too small, and we have roles for people of all ages!  For students, volunteering is a great way to complete your community service hour requirements.

The Festival is the primary fundraising event for the Nesmith Library.  It helps to support the many educational and cultural programs the library offers.
